Abstract
The utility model discloses a kind of new pump plungers, including plunger case, the first circular hole is provided on the right side outer surface of the plunger case, plunger is slidably connected on the inner surface of first circular hole, piston is fixedly connected on the left outer surface of the plunger, the outer surface of the piston and the inner surface of plunger case are slidably connected, rubber block is fixedly connected on the left outer surface of the piston, the first annulus is fixedly connected on the outer surface of the plunger, the outer surface of first annulus and the inner surface of plunger case are slidably connected, the first spring is fixedly connected on the right side outer surface of first annulus, the new pump plunger, there is buffer unit to be buffered in the process of movement in plunger, it reduces and the rear and front end of plunger case is hit, extend the service life of plunger pump, and fuel feeding is carried out without external force during the work time , structure is simple, reduces production cost.

Background technique
Plunger pump is an important device of hydraulic system, it is moved back and forth in cylinder body by plunger, makes seal operation
The volume of cavity changes to realize oil suction, pressure oil, plunger pump high, compact-sized, high-efficient and flow with rated pressure
The advantages that easy to adjust.
Currently, movement can generate vibration to existing majority plunger repeatedly at work, make a noise, mistake of the plunger in movement
The rear and front end of plunger case is hit in journey back and forth, it is prolonged to hit the damage that will cause plunger pump, influence the use of plunger pump
Service life, and existing most plunger pumps need external force to carry out fuel feeding at work, and structure is complicated, while increasing and being produced into
This.
